The Ideal Software Radio: Hardware Radio Separate devices for different functions Any fix or upgrade needs a hardware change The Ideal Software Radio Software Radio One device for many functions Upgrade through software changeSoftware Radio + Remote Antennas: Software Radio + Remote Antennas Extended Coverage Shared Infrastructure Better Spectrum Utilization Future Proofing Lower Capital Cost New Revenue sources Fiber or cable backbone Software Radio ClusterDynamic Spectrum Utilization: Dynamic Spectrum UtilizationBenefits: Benefits Better Spectrum Utilization System optimized to current channel conditions, user requirements and network traffic Dynamic Spectrum Optimization Make spectrum a commodity Should be able to sublicense portions as needed Use is a function of demand, not regulation Adapts to regional and time sensitive requirements Enable priority access Faster Technology Tracking New services and signal processing are software upgrades Leads to new revenue and even better spectrum utilization Outline: Outline Where are we going ? Evolution of Software Radio: Evolution of Software Radio Dual-mode cell phone Modal SDR Software controls and configures the radio ASIC or analog hardwareEvolution of Software Radio: Evolution of Software Radio Dual-mode cell phone Modal SDR Software controls and configures the radio ASIC or analog hardware Reconfigurable SDR All signal processing reconfigurable Significant use of FPGA or assembly code SpeakEasy AirNetEvolution of Software Radio: Evolution of Software Radio Dual-mode cell phone Modal SDR Software controls and configures the radio ASIC or analog hardware Reconfigurable SDR All signal processing reconfigurable Significant use of FPGA or assembly code SpeakEasy AirNet Software Radio (SWR) Takes advantage of Moore’s Law Portable programs VanuSoftware Radio Phase Space: Source: Mitola, Joseph. “Software Radio Architecture: A Mathematical Perspective”, IEEE JSAC, April 1999. Software Radio X: Ideal Software Radio Software Radio Phase SpaceState Of Software Radio: State Of Software Radio Technology is mature for infrastructure Basestations Public safety Wireless LAN/MAN/last mile Demonstrated capability at CTIA Cellular Handsets are 3-5 years away Power dissipation constraint Applicable to lower battery like markets today e.g. law enforcement, vehicularOutline: Outline Where are we going ? Next Steps: Next Steps SDR Rulemaking is a great start Spectrum licensing needs to be less static SDR device approval needs to expand to include over the air upgradesDynamic Spectrum: Dynamic Spectrum Secondary markets would be a good first step Allows some ability to adapt Long term goal: Commodity spectrum market Computerized market maker Authorized traders Need to meet non-interference regualtions Support smaller geographic blocks Real-time bids Acquire spectrum for the region and time requiredSDR Waveform Downloads: SDR Waveform Downloads Essential to realize the benefits Spectrum efficiency Technology tracking Platform certification Insure no harmful interference, even with malicious software Radiate under power limitations Within allowed bandwidth Cannot theoretically guarantee correct functionality Can guarantee that it does NOT do certain harmful things Summary: Summary Software Radio will enable Better spectrum utilization Faster technology tracking New markets and uses for wireless Tremendous progress in the last decade Technology ready for infrastructure today Handsets coming fast Regulation Off to a good start with SDR rule making Next steps: More dynamic spectrum allocation Downloadable waveform upgrades You do not have the permission to view this presentation.
